注:网上看了很多版本,但是很多都需要付出极大的代价,什么降低版本到4.1.0,在main.js设置window.wx = undefined等等。
在尽量不改变echarts的情况下解决点击事件失效问题方案:
首先在main.js引入echarts
//引入
import * as echarts from 'echarts';
//全局挂载它
Vue.prototype.$echarts=echarts;
在mounted添加以下代码:
mounted(){
//这两行代码解决在小程序中echarts点击失效问题
this.$echarts.env.touchEventsSupported = false;
this.$echarts.env.wxa = false;
},